Definition
Describing something that does not have acidic properties or content.
Example
The nonacid solution is safe to use on sensitive skin.

Root Explanation
Nonacid → It is formed from "non-" (meaning not) and "acid" (from Latin "acidus", meaning sour or sharp). The word "nonacid" means not sour or lacking acidity.
